Summary of
Hardware Features
Table 3 summarizes the hardware features that are supported by the
Switches.
Table 3 Hardware features
Feature Switch 4900 Series
Fast Ethernet
and Gigabit
Ethernet Ports
Switch 4900: 12 Auto-negotiating 100BASE-TX/1000BASE-T
ports
Switch 4900 SX: 12 Auto-negotiating 1000BASE-SX ports
Switch 4924: 24 Auto-negotiating
10BASE-T/100BASE-TX/1000BASE-T ports
Switch 4950: 12 Auto-negotiating
10BASE-T/100BASE-TX/1000BASE-T, 6 1000BASE-SX and
6 GBIC ports
Addresses Up to 12,000 supported
Up to 64 permanent entries
Forwarding
Modes
Store and Forward
Duplex Modes Half duplex only supported on
10BASE-T/100BASE-TX/1000BASE-T ports in 10/100 Mbps
mode
All 1000 Mbps ports are full duplex only
Flow Control Supported on all ports
Smart
auto-sensing
Supported on all 10BASE-T/100BASE-TX/1000BASE-T ports
Not supported on 1000BASE-SX and GBIC ports
Traffic
Prioritization
Supported (IEEE Std 802.1D, 1998 Edition)
Four traffic queues per port
Layer 3
Switching
Support for wire-speed IP routing
RPS Support Connects to SuperStack 3 Advanced Redundant Power System
(ARPS) (3C16071B)
XRN Support eXpandable Resilient Networking (XRN) support. Allows
interconnection of two units to create a Distributed Fabric.
Mounting 19-inch rack or stand-alone mounting
